NNenanMy flight arrived in Kathmandu at 10 PM, and immigration took forever, so I didn't get out of the airport until almost 11 PM. I had emailed the hotel in advance to request an airport pick-up. I honestly thought no one would be there given how late it was and the lack of a contact number, but I saw my name card among the crowd waiting for cars at the exit. As a first-time visitor, this was such a pleasant and heartwarming surprise! The car took me to the hotel, which is located in the bustling, central Thamel area. Right downstairs, there's a 'Chengdu Skewers' restaurant. The hotel itself is one of the tallest buildings in the vicinity and boasts a glass-enclosed restaurant on the 12th-floor rooftop, with a pool and spa on the 11th floor – quite a bold design! Breakfast was good, and the service was attentive. The location is convenient; a rickshaw takes just 6 minutes to Durbar Square. The room size was adequate, but I was a bit disappointed to only get a room on the 4th floor after requesting a high-floor room. Also, the bathroom had a strong, foul odor that permeated the room even with the bathroom door closed. This backflow smell seems to be related to the plumbing and hygiene and definitely needs improvement. Other than that, everything else was great!

GGuest UserThe hotel service is very professional, the breakfast is rich, and the front desk service is warm and thoughtful. When I asked for water, it was delivered quickly. There is also a hair dryer in the hotel, and the hot water for bathing is very comfortable. Many Chinese people go to other places to find Chinese food, but they find that the most authentic Chinese food is on the ninth floor above the hotel. And the chocolate brownie here is very authentic. It was supposed to be eaten with ice cream, but I asked for hot ice cream, and the hotel immediately made hot ice cream. There is the largest farmer's market in Kathmandu next to the hotel, and 6 big apples cost less than 20 yuan. You can buy all kinds of vegetables and fruits here. Because Kathmandu is often congested, if you connect with a flight, the hotel is very close to the airport, which is another big advantage.
